Bourbon County High School vs Paris High School

Bourbon County High School and Paris High School are very closely rated, both scoring around 5.9 out of 10. Bourbon County High School is significantly larger with 796 students, about 3.4× the size of Paris High School (231). In math proficiency, Paris High School leads at 44.5%.
